How To Deal With Menstrual Fatigue?
Menstrual fatigue occurs right before your period every month. It causes discomfort, tiredness, mood swings, headaches, bloating, etc
It is difficult to suppress menstrual fatigue instantly. However, one can focus on certain lifestyle changes to fight this fatigue
Here are some tips to deal with menstrual fatigue
Make sure to skip screen time an hour before your bedtime. Avoid heavy meals and caffeine 4 to 6 hours before bed
To ward off menstrual fatigue, it is essential to stay active. Do low-intensity exercises like jogging or practice yoga to regain energy
You may crave sweet treats or other unhealthy foods. Do not binge eat, especially processed food as they may leave you feeling bloated
Dehydration is one of the main reasons you feel tired. Consume adequate water to stay hydrated. Avoid caffeinated beverages, sugary drinks and alcohol
